Summary

Gameboard or gaming pieces for a lottery game, with thirty-eight blocks of illustrations. Each block is an contains a named object, in Spanish. No instructions appear on this gameboard.
Publicado por la Test. de A. Vanegas Arroyo, 2a Sta. Teresa 40. Rgdo. a la ley.
Posada's Mexico / Ron Tyler. Washington, D.C. : Library of Congress, 1979, p. 191.
Purchase; Caroline and Erwin Swann Memorial Fund; 1978; (DLC/PP-1978:107.003).
Exhibited in "Posada's Mexico," Library of Congress, 1979-1980.
Exhibited: La Lotería : una ventana en la cultura y historia de Mexico, Sioux City Art Center, Sioux City, Iowa, 2005.
